Scripture Focus

24And the children of Israel departed thence at that time, every man to his tribe and to his family, and they went out from thence every man to his inheritance.
Judges 21:24

Biblical Context

The verse shows the Israelites dispersing to their tribes and households and each going to his inheritance.

Neville's Inner Vision

Picture the scene as a symbol for your own self moving to its native estate. The children of Israel, not scattered, are states of consciousness returning to their rightful places. The tribes are the dispositions of your mind; the families are the lines of your life you tend with care. When they depart thence, every man to his inheritance, you are witnessing the moment when your awareness ceases wandering and settles into its natural endowment. In Neville's terms, 'the I AM' witnesses the cast of characters of your inner life stepping from the crowd and taking possession of its divine grant. There is no external struggle here; this is an inner settlement where each facet of self is given its due, and unity is the natural consequence. By assuming you are already living in your own estate, you align with the reality that your world follows your inner architecture. Your life is the result of your inner decree; the division you feel dissolves as you recognise and claim your true inheritance.

Practice This Now

Close your eyes and imagine you are returning to your inner tribe, seeing each part of you stepping into its rightful estate. Then declare, 'I am now in my inheritance,' and feel the gratitude.
